B**B
Slow RPM and high torque, but teeth broke after 4th test.
Motor did what it said. Slow RPM, but on the 4th test teeth broke.It's designed for kids toys, but I wanted to see if it could tilt a pvc pipe with a 100w solar panel. Hooked up the motor to 2 mini 5v poly solar panels. Hooked one panel positive to positive and the other positive to negative.1 solar panel turned clockwise, other solar panel turned counter-clockwise. The motor didn't need to rotate the pvc pipe quickly as it would be put in shade, and only rotate once enough sunlight hit the 5v mini panel, which tilted the 100w panel. All good.Until I Hooked up motor with a wheel and tubing to turn the pvc pipe. The motor couldn't handle the weight of the tilt. Broke the teeth.But hey, it was a test to see IF. ...and unfortunately it can't.Just save your money and buy a 2nd 100w solar panel to create an upsidedown V. This will maximize captured sunlight without needing to tilt the panel on my roof twice a day.
J**N
Great torque, but slow
I was hoping these were a bit faster than they are. I'd guess about 1 revolution every 5 seconds. I wanted these for a small RC car because the first motors I tried wern't strong enough. I paired these up with large wheel to make it a bit faster, and I may try a gearing ratio.However, they do have plenty of torque, so for that, they work quite well. I just though they would be faster. I'm controlling them via an H-Bridge, 9V battery, and Arduino using PWM.
